Comprehensive Guide to 2015 Tax Form

What is the 2015 US Federal Tax Return Form?

The 2015 US Federal Tax Return Form is essential for reporting income, expenses, and financial information to the Internal Revenue Service (IRS). This form is required for individuals filing their taxes, along with their spouses, to ensure compliance with tax laws. Completing this form is crucial for taxpayers in accurately reporting their financial standing for the 2015 tax year.

Purpose and Benefits of the 2015 US Federal Tax Return Form

Filing the 2015 US Federal Tax Return Form is a legal obligation for both individuals and couples in the United States. Accurate reporting through this IRS tax form 2015 facilitates potential tax refunds and helps avoid penalties associated with underreporting. Additionally, it allows taxpayers to take advantage of various deductions and credits available for the tax year.

Common Errors and How to Avoid Them

Many taxpayers encounter frequent mistakes when filling out the 2015 US Federal Tax Return Form. Common errors include inaccuracies in personal details and income reporting. To mitigate these issues, double-check your entries and validate information before submission. Ensure that you are aware of the tax form for 2015 requirements to minimize potential rejections.

Any individual or couple filing taxes for the tax year 2015 can use the 2015 US Federal Tax Return Form. This includes employees, self-employed individuals, and their spouses.
You can submit your completed 2015 tax return electronically via tax software like pdfFiller or by mailing a printed version to the IRS address listed on the form.
Key documents include W-2 forms, 1099s, bank statements, and receipts for deductions. Ensure all income sources are documented before filing.
Common mistakes include incorrect Social Security numbers, math errors, and leaving required fields blank. Double-check all information before submission.
Typically, the IRS takes about 21 days to process electronic returns. Paper returns may take longer, sometimes several weeks.
